Characteristic features of PCFCL and PCLBCL, leg type
. | PCFCL . | PCLBCL, leg type . |
---|---|---|
Morphology | Predominance of centrocytes that are often large, especially in diffuse lesions. | Predominance or confluent sheets of medium-sized to large B cells with round nuclei, prominent nucleoli, and coarse chromatin resembling centroblasts and/or immunoblasts. |
Centroblasts may be present, but not in confluent sheets. | Diffuse growth pattern. | |
Growth pattern may be follicular, follicular and diffuse, or diffuse (a continuum without distinct categories or grades). | ||
Phenotype | Bcl-2: -/+* | Bcl-2: ++‡ |
Bcl-6: + | Bcl-6: +/- | |
CD10: -/+† | CD10: - | |
Mum-1: - | Mum-1: + | |
Clinical features | Middle-aged adults. | Elderly, especially females, |
Localized lesions on head or trunk (90%). | Lesions localized on leg(s), most often below the knee. | |
Multifocal lesions in rare cases. | Rare cases with lesions at other sites than the leg (10%). |
